The European Commission's report 'Analysis of life-cycle greenhouse gas emissions of EU buildings and construction' evaluates strategies and policy scenarios aimed at decarbonising the EU building sector by 2050.

The report assesses six emission-reduction strategies based on the 'avoid, shift, improve' framework, covering the entire building life cycle. Additionally, it examines six policy scenarios with varying levels of ambition and integration of these strategies.

The findings aim to guide effective policy-making at both the EU and Member State levels to achieve significant emissions reductions in the building sector.
